(g) "Zip-gun" means any of the following:
<br />(1) Any firearm of crude and extemporized manufacture;
<br />(2) Any device, including without limitation a starter's pistol, that is not
<br />designed as a firearm, but that is specially adapted for use as a firearm;
<br />(3) Any industrial tool, signalling device or safety device, that is not
<br />designed as a firearm, but that as designed is capable of use as such,
<br />when possessed, carried or used as a firearm.
<br />(h) "Explosive device" means any device designed or specially adapted to cause
<br />physical harm to persons or property by means of an explosion, and consisting
<br />of an explosive substance or agency and a means to detonate it. "Explosive
<br />device" includes without limitation any bomb, any explosive demolition
<br />device, any blasting cap or detonator containing an explosive charge, and any
<br />pressure vessel that has been knowingly tampered with or arranged so as to
<br />explode.
<br />(i) "Incendiary device" means any firebomb, and any device designed or specially
<br />adapted to cause physical harm to persons or property by means of fire, and
<br />consisting of an incendiary substance or agency and a means.to ignite it.
<br />(j) "Ballistic knife" means a knife with a detachable blade that is propelled by a
<br />spring-operated mechanism.
<br />(k) "Dangerous ordnance" means any of the following, except as provided in
<br />subsection (1) hereof:
<br />(1) Any automatic or sawed-off firearm, zip-gun or ballistic knife;
<br />(2) Any explosive device or incendiary device;
<br />(3) Nitroglycerin, nitrocellulose, nitrostarch, PETN, cyclonite, TNT,
<br />picric acid and other high explosives; amatol, tritonal, tetrytol,
<br />pentolite, pecretol; cyclotol and other high explosive compositions;
<br />plastic explosives; dynamite, blasting gelatin, gelatin dynamite,
<br />sensitized ammonium nitrate, liquid-oxygen blasting explosives,
<br />blasting powder and other blasting agents; and any other explosive
<br />substance having sufficient brisance or power to be particularly suitable
<br />for use as a military explosive, or for use in mining, quarrying,
<br />excavating or demolitions;
<br />(4) Any firearm, rocket launcher, mortar, artillery piece, grenade, mine,
<br />bomb, torpedo or similar weapon, designed and manufactured for
<br />military purposes, and the ammunition for that weapon;
<br />(5) Any firearm muffler or silencer;
<br />(6) Any combination of parts that is intended by the owner for use in
<br />converting any firearm or other device into a dangerous ordnance.
<br />(1) "Dangerous ordnance" does not include any of the following:
<br />(1) Any firearm, including a military weapon and the ammunition for that
<br />weapon, and regardless of its actual age, that employs a percussion cap
<br />or other obsolete ignition system, or that is designed and safe for use
<br />only with black powder;
<br />(2) Any pistol, rifle or shotgun, designed or suitable for sporting purposes,
<br />including a military weapon as issued or as modified, and the
<br />ammunition for that weapon unless the firearm is an automatic or
<br />sawed-off firearm;
<br />(3) Any cannon or other artillery piece that, regardless of its actual age, is
<br />of a type in accepted use prior to 1887, has no mechanical, hydraulic,
<br />pneumatic or other system for absorbing recoil and returning the tube
<br />into battery without displacing the carriage, and is designed and safe
<br />for use only with black powder;
